For a 48 V nominal rail this gives you roughly 1.1× headroom in normal operation and a clamping ratio of about 2.8× under surge — the gap between 94.4 V breakdown and 137 V clamping is the margin the series impedance of the rail and any upstream fuse or inductor must buy you before the TVS takes over. This is a unidirectional device — it protects a positive-going transient relative to ground, not a bidirectional AC rail. For a 48 V positive bus with transients referenced to ground, the 1.5SMCJ85A does the job. For a dual-polarity or AC line you would need the bidirectional variant. ## Peak pulse power and current ratings The 1500 W peak pulse rating (1.5 kW) defines the device's energy-withstand capability in the standard 10/1000 µs waveform — this is the IEC 61000-4-5 surge class test wave shape, so the spec maps directly to what the device survives in a compliance test. At that same 10/1000 µs waveform the peak pulse current is 10.9 A; this is the current the TVS actually shunts during the event, and your upstream protection (fuse, PTC, or supply current limit) must survive the same event without opening the protected rail upstream of the TVS. ## DO-214AB package and thermal environment The SMC (DO-214AB) package is the standard footprint for 1500 W unidirectional TVS diodes across multiple manufacturers — a board laid out for this footprint can accept pin-compatible parts from other sources without a spin. Junction temperature range is -50°C to 150°C, which covers industrial enclosures and outdoor enclosures without derating concerns at room ambient — the 150°C ceiling is the thermal limit, so monitor board-level temperature rise under sustained overload conditions.","metaTitle":"Diotec 1.5SMCJ85A TVS Diode, 85V Standoff, DO-214AB","metaDescription":"Diotec 1.5SMCJ85A unidirectional TVS Zener, 85V standoff, 137V clamping max, 1500W peak pulse, DO-214AB SMC surface mount.
